Pro Bowl safety Dashon Goldson, the team's unsigned franchise player, continues to be the only member of the team's 90-man roster who has not attended any of the 49ers' offseason program. A league source told CSNBayArea.com that Goldson, set to earn $6.212 million in 2012 as the team's franchise player, is seeking a long-term deal similar to the five-year, $40 million contract safety Eric Weddle signed last year with the San Diego Chargers.
